00127 
00128 /** Callback type for checking authorization on paths produced by
00129  * the repository commit editor.
00130  *
00131  * Set @a *allowed to TRUE to indicate that the @a required access on
00132  * @a path in @a root is authorized, or set it to FALSE to indicate
00133  * unauthorized (presumable according to state stored in @a baton).
00134  *
00135  * If @a path is NULL, the callback should perform a global authz
00136  * lookup for the @a required access.  That is, the lookup should
00137  * check if the @a required access is granted for at least one path of
00138  * the repository, and set @a *allowed to TRUE if so.  @a root may
00139  * also be NULL if @a path is NULL.
00140  *
00141  * This callback is very similar to svn_repos_authz_func_t, with the
00142  * exception of the addition of the @a required parameter.
00143  * This is due to historical reasons: when authz was first implemented
00144  * for svn_repos_dir_delta2(), it seemed there would need only checks
00145  * for read and write operations, hence the svn_repos_authz_func_t
00146  * callback prototype and usage scenario.  But it was then realized
00147  * that lookups due to copying needed to be recursive, and that
00148  * brute-force recursive lookups didn't square with the O(1)
00149  * performances a copy operation should have.
00150  *
00151  * So a special way to ask for a recursive lookup was introduced.  The
00152  * commit editor needs this capability to retain acceptable
00153  * performance.  Instead of revving the existing callback, causing
00154  * unnecessary revving of functions that don't actually need the
00155  * extended functionality, this second, more complete callback was
00156  * introduced, for use by the commit editor.
00157  *
00158  * Some day, it would be nice to reunite these two callbacks and do
00159  * the necessary revving anyway, but for the time being, this dual
00160  * callback mechanism will do.
00161  */
00162 typedef svn_error_t *(*svn_repos_authz_callback_t)
00163   (svn_repos_authz_access_t required,
00164    svn_boolean_t *allowed,
00165    svn_fs_root_t *root,
00166    const char *path,
00167    void *baton,
00168    apr_pool_t *pool);

00414 
00415 /**
00416  * Upgrade the Subversion repository (and its underlying versioned
00417  * filesystem) located in the directory @a path to the latest version
00418  * supported by this library.  If the requested upgrade is not
00419  * supported due to the current state of the repository or it
00420  * underlying filesystem, return #SVN_ERR_REPOS_UNSUPPORTED_UPGRADE
00421  * or #SVN_ERR_FS_UNSUPPORTED_UPGRADE (respectively) and make no
00422  * changes to the repository or filesystem.
00423  *
00424  * Acquires an exclusive lock on the repository, upgrades the
00425  * repository, and releases the lock.  If an exclusive lock can't be
00426  * acquired, returns error.
00427  *
00428  * If @a nonblocking is TRUE, an error of type EWOULDBLOCK is
00429  * returned if the lock is not immediately available.
00430  *
00431  * If @a start_callback is not NULL, it will be called with @a
00432  * start_callback_baton as argument before the upgrade starts, but
00433  * after the exclusive lock has been acquired.
00434  *
00435  * Use @a pool for necessary allocations.
00436  *
00437  * @note This functionality is provided as a convenience for
00438  * administrators wishing to make use of new Subversion functionality
00439  * without a potentially costly full repository dump/load.  As such,
00440  * the operation performs only the minimum amount of work needed to
00441  * accomplish this while maintaining the integrity of the repository.
00442  * It does *not* guarantee the most optimized repository state as a
00443  * dump and subsequent load would.
00444  *
00445  * @note On some platforms the exclusive lock does not exclude other
00446  * threads in the same process so this function should only be called
00447  * by a single threaded process, or by a multi-threaded process when
00448  * no other threads are accessing the repository.
00449  *
00450  * @since New in 1.7.
00451  */
00452 svn_error_t *
00453 svn_repos_upgrade2(const char *path,
00454                    svn_boolean_t nonblocking,
00455                    svn_repos_notify_func_t notify_func,
00456                    void *notify_baton,
00457                    apr_pool_t *pool);

00836 
00837 /**
00838  * Construct and return a @a report_baton that will be passed to the
00839  * other functions in this section to describe the state of a pre-existing
00840  * tree (typically, a working copy).  When the report is finished,
00841  * @a editor/@a edit_baton will be driven in such a way as to transform the
00842  * existing tree to @a revnum and, if @a tgt_path is non-NULL, switch the
00843  * reported hierarchy to @a tgt_path.
00844  *
00845  * @a fs_base is the absolute path of the node in the filesystem at which
00846  * the comparison should be rooted.  @a target is a single path component,
00847  * used to limit the scope of the report to a single entry of @a fs_base,
00848  * or "" if all of @a fs_base itself is the main subject of the report.
00849  *
00850  * @a tgt_path and @a revnum is the fs path/revision pair that is the
00851  * "target" of the delta.  @a tgt_path should be provided only when
00852  * the source and target paths of the report differ.  That is, @a tgt_path
00853  * should *only* be specified when specifying that the resultant editor
00854  * drive be one that transforms the reported hierarchy into a pristine tree
00855  * of @a tgt_path at revision @a revnum.  A @c NULL value for @a tgt_path
00856  * will indicate that the editor should be driven in such a way as to
00857  * transform the reported hierarchy to revision @a revnum, preserving the
00858  * reported hierarchy.
00859  *
00860  * @a text_deltas instructs the driver of the @a editor to enable
00861  * the generation of text deltas.
00862  *
00863  * @a ignore_ancestry instructs the driver to ignore node ancestry
00864  * when determining how to transmit differences.
00865  *
00866  * @a send_copyfrom_args instructs the driver to send 'copyfrom'
00867  * arguments to the editor's add_file() and add_directory() methods,
00868  * whenever it deems feasible.
00869  *
00870  * Use @a authz_read_func and @a authz_read_baton (if not @c NULL) to
00871  * avoid sending data through @a editor/@a edit_baton which is not
00872  * authorized for transmission.
00873  *
00874  * @a zero_copy_limit controls the maximum size (in bytes) at which
00875  * data blocks may be sent using the zero-copy code path.  On that
00876  * path, a number of in-memory copy operations have been eliminated to
00877  * maximize throughput.  However, until the whole block has been
00878  * pushed to the network stack, other clients block, so be careful
00879  * when using larger values here.  Pass 0 for @a zero_copy_limit to
00880  * disable this optimization altogether.
00881  *
00882  * @a note Never activate this optimization if @a editor might access
00883  * any FSFS data structures (and, hence, caches).  So, it is basically
00884  * safe for networked editors only.
00885  *
00886  * All allocation for the context and collected state will occur in
00887  * @a pool.
00888  *
00889  * @a depth is the requested depth of the editor drive.
00890  *
00891  * If @a depth is #svn_depth_unknown, the editor will affect only the
00892  * paths reported by the individual calls to svn_repos_set_path3() and
00893  * svn_repos_link_path3().
00894  *
00895  * For example, if the reported tree is the @c A subdir of the Greek Tree
00896  * (see Subversion's test suite), at depth #svn_depth_empty, but the
00897  * @c A/B subdir is reported at depth #svn_depth_infinity, then
00898  * repository-side changes to @c A/mu, or underneath @c A/C and @c
00899  * A/D, would not be reflected in the editor drive, but changes
00900  * underneath @c A/B would be.
00901  *
00902  * Additionally, the editor driver will call @c add_directory and
00903  * and @c add_file for directories with an appropriate depth.  For
00904  * example, a directory reported at #svn_depth_files will receive
00905  * file (but not directory) additions.  A directory at #svn_depth_empty
00906  * will receive neither.
00907  *
00908  * If @a depth is #svn_depth_files, #svn_depth_immediates or
00909  * #svn_depth_infinity and @a depth is greater than the reported depth
00910  * of the working copy, then the editor driver will emit editor
00911  * operations so as to upgrade the working copy to this depth.
00912  *
00913  * If @a depth is #svn_depth_empty, #svn_depth_files,
00914  * #svn_depth_immediates and @a depth is lower
00915  * than or equal to the depth of the working copy, then the editor
00916  * operations will affect only paths at or above @a depth.
00917  *
00918  * @since New in 1.8.
00919  */
00920 svn_error_t *
00921 svn_repos_begin_report3(void **report_baton,
00922                         svn_revnum_t revnum,
00923                         svn_repos_t *repos,
00924                         const char *fs_base,
00925                         const char *target,
00926                         const char *tgt_path,
00927                         svn_boolean_t text_deltas,
00928                         svn_depth_t depth,
00929                         svn_boolean_t ignore_ancestry,
00930                         svn_boolean_t send_copyfrom_args,
00931                         const svn_delta_editor_t *editor,
00932                         void *edit_baton,
00933                         svn_repos_authz_func_t authz_read_func,
00934                         void *authz_read_baton,
00935                         apr_size_t zero_copy_limit,
00936                         apr_pool_t *pool);

01181 
01182 /** Use the provided @a editor and @a edit_baton to describe the changes
01183  * necessary for making a given node (and its descendants, if it is a
01184  * directory) under @a src_root look exactly like @a tgt_path under
01185  * @a tgt_root.  @a src_entry is the node to update.  If @a src_entry
01186  * is empty, then compute the difference between the entire tree
01187  * anchored at @a src_parent_dir under @a src_root and @a tgt_path
01188  * under @a tgt_root.  Else, describe the changes needed to update
01189  * only that entry in @a src_parent_dir.  Typically, callers of this
01190  * function will use a @a tgt_path that is the concatenation of @a
01191  * src_parent_dir and @a src_entry.
01192  *
01193  * @a src_root and @a tgt_root can both be either revision or transaction
01194  * roots.  If @a tgt_root is a revision, @a editor's set_target_revision()
01195  * will be called with the @a tgt_root's revision number, else it will
01196  * not be called at all.
01197  *
01198  * If @a authz_read_func is non-NULL, invoke it before any call to
01199  *
01200  *    @a editor->open_root
01201  *    @a editor->add_directory
01202  *    @a editor->open_directory
01203  *    @a editor->add_file
01204  *    @a editor->open_file
01205  *
01206  * passing @a tgt_root, the same path that would be passed to the
01207  * editor function in question, and @a authz_read_baton.  If the
01208  * @a *allowed parameter comes back TRUE, then proceed with the planned
01209  * editor call; else if FALSE, then invoke @a editor->absent_file or
01210  * @a editor->absent_directory as appropriate, except if the planned
01211  * editor call was open_root, throw SVN_ERR_AUTHZ_ROOT_UNREADABLE.
01212  *
01213  * If @a text_deltas is @c FALSE, send a single @c NULL txdelta window to
01214  * the window handler returned by @a editor->apply_textdelta().
01215  *
01216  * If @a depth is #svn_depth_empty, invoke @a editor calls only on
01217  * @a src_entry (or @a src_parent_dir, if @a src_entry is empty).
01218  * If @a depth is #svn_depth_files, also invoke the editor on file
01219  * children, if any; if #svn_depth_immediates, invoke it on
01220  * immediate subdirectories as well as files; if #svn_depth_infinity,
01221  * recurse fully.
01222  *
01223  * If @a entry_props is @c TRUE, accompany each opened/added entry with
01224  * propchange editor calls that relay special "entry props" (this
01225  * is typically used only for working copy updates).
01226  *
01227  * @a ignore_ancestry instructs the function to ignore node ancestry
01228  * when determining how to transmit differences.
01229  *
01230  * Before completing successfully, this function calls @a editor's
01231  * close_edit(), so the caller should expect its @a edit_baton to be
01232  * invalid after its use with this function.
01233  *
01234  * Do any allocation necessary for the delta computation in @a pool.
01235  * This function's maximum memory consumption is at most roughly
01236  * proportional to the greatest depth of the tree under @a tgt_root, not
01237  * the total size of the delta.
01238  *
01239  * ### svn_repos_dir_delta2 is mostly superseded by the reporter
01240  * ### functionality (svn_repos_begin_report3 and friends).
01241  * ### svn_repos_dir_delta2 does allow the roots to be transaction
01242  * ### roots rather than just revision roots, and it has the
01243  * ### entry_props flag.  Almost all of Subversion's own code uses the
01244  * ### reporter instead; there are some stray references to the
01245  * ### svn_repos_dir_delta[2] in comments which should probably
01246  * ### actually refer to the reporter.
01247  *
01248  * @since New in 1.5.
01249  */
01250 svn_error_t *
01251 svn_repos_dir_delta2(svn_fs_root_t *src_root,
01252                      const char *src_parent_dir,
01253                      const char *src_entry,
01254                      svn_fs_root_t *tgt_root,
01255                      const char *tgt_path,
01256                      const svn_delta_editor_t *editor,
01257                      void *edit_baton,
01258                      svn_repos_authz_func_t authz_read_func,
01259                      void *authz_read_baton,
01260                      svn_boolean_t text_deltas,
01261                      svn_depth_t depth,
01262                      svn_boolean_t entry_props,
01263                      svn_boolean_t ignore_ancestry,
01264                      apr_pool_t *pool);

02476 
02477 /**
02478  * @defgroup svn_repos_dump_load Dumping and loading filesystem data
02479  * @{
02480  *
02481  * The filesystem 'dump' format contains nothing but the abstract
02482  * structure of the filesystem -- independent of any internal node-id
02483  * schema or database back-end.  All of the data in the dumpfile is
02484  * acquired by public function calls into svn_fs.h.  Similarly, the
02485  * parser which reads the dumpfile is able to reconstruct the
02486  * filesystem using only public svn_fs.h routines.
02487  *
02488  * Thus the dump/load feature's main purpose is for *migrating* data
02489  * from one svn filesystem to another -- presumably two filesystems
02490  * which have different internal implementations.
02491  *
02492  * If you simply want to backup your filesystem, you're probably
02493  * better off using the built-in facilities of the DB backend (using
02494  * Berkeley DB's hot-backup feature, for example.)
02495  *
02496  * For a description of the dumpfile format, see
02497  * /trunk/notes/fs_dumprestore.txt.
02498  */

03256 
03257 
03258 /** Revision Access Levels
03259  *
03260  * Like most version control systems, access to versioned objects in
03261  * Subversion is determined on primarily path-based system.  Users either
03262  * do or don't have the ability to read a given path.
03263  *
03264  * However, unlike many version control systems where versioned objects
03265  * maintain their own distinct version information (revision numbers,
03266  * authors, log messages, change timestamps, etc.), Subversion binds
03267  * multiple paths changed as part of a single commit operation into a
03268  * set, calls the whole thing a revision, and hangs commit metadata
03269  * (author, date, log message, etc.) off of that revision.  So, commit
03270  * metadata is shared across all the paths changed as part of a given
03271  * commit operation.
03272  *
03273  * It is common (or, at least, we hope it is) for log messages to give
03274  * detailed information about changes made in the commit to which the log
03275  * message is attached.  Such information might include a mention of all
03276  * the files changed, what was changed in them, and so on.  But this
03277  * causes a problem when presenting information to readers who aren't
03278  * authorized to read every path in the repository.  Simply knowing that
03279  * a given path exists may be a security leak, even if the user can't see
03280  * the contents of the data located at that path.
03281  *
03282  * So Subversion does what it reasonably can to prevent the leak of this
03283  * information, and does so via a staged revision access policy.  A
03284  * reader can be said to have one of three levels of access to a given
03285  * revision's metadata, based solely on the reader's access rights to the
03286  * paths changed or copied in that revision:
03287  *
03288  *   'full access' -- Granted when the reader has access to all paths
03289  *      changed or copied in the revision, or when no paths were
03290  *      changed in the revision at all, this access level permits
03291  *      full visibility of all revision property names and values,
03292  *      and the full changed-paths information.
03293  *
03294  *   'no access' -- Granted when the reader does not have access to any
03295  *      paths changed or copied in the revision, this access level
03296  *      denies the reader access to all revision properties and all
03297  *      changed-paths information.
03298  *
03299  *   'partial access' -- Granted when the reader has access to at least
03300  *      one, but not all, of the paths changed or copied in the revision,
03301  *      this access level permits visibility of the svn:date and
03302  *      svn:author revision properties and only the paths of the
03303  *      changed-paths information to which the reader has access.
03304  *
03305  */
03306 
03307 
03308 /** An enum defining levels of revision access.
03309  *
03310  * @since New in 1.5.
03311  */
03312 typedef enum svn_repos_revision_access_level_t
03313 {
03314   /** no access allowed to the revision properties and all changed-paths
03315    * information. */ 
03316   svn_repos_revision_access_none,
03317   /** access granted to some (svn:date and svn:author) revision properties and
03318    * changed-paths information on paths the read has access to. */
03319   svn_repos_revision_access_partial,
03320   /** access granted to all revision properites and changed-paths
03321    * information. */
03322   svn_repos_revision_access_full
03323 }
03324 svn_repos_revision_access_level_t;
